Rapport

Rapport is crucial for business. It allows you to develop good relationships quickly - a particularly important skill in China. Relationships may be built up over months or even years, but what if you do not have months or years? Is it possible to build a relationship more quickly?

Indeed it is. If you doubt this, consider your current close friends. No doubt you have some friends with whom a deep connection developed very quickly. On the other hand, you may have some colleagues with whom you talk every day but do not become close. What accounts for this difference? How can you consistently develop strong relationships quickly?

Rapport is a sense that you share a connection with another person. Research has shown that rapport depends on body language, tone and pace of speech and other factors in predictable ways.
